Hello, my name is Chris and this is my first post on this forum. Thank you in advance for all of you who take time out of your night to help me.

I just replaced my front differential in my wife's mountaineer, all I had left to do is reattach the front driveshaft to the differential yoke. For some reason the U joint strap bolts won't fit back in the yoke.

To make things worse I broke a bolt off in the yoke trying to make it go in. I was almost done, and now I don't know what to do. I'm going to attach a video to better illustrate what I mean. Any help is greatly appreciated.

Edit: won't let me attach the video, says security error.
 






You will need to remove the broken bolt with a drill and an extractor.
You will also need to determine if the replacement differential has different thread pitch on the yoke. The threads may just need to be chased. You have to match the bolts to the yoke.

It's not going to be easy, but it is rudimentary mechanic work.
